đ REAL TALK
Most days my 9âyearâold hops in the car, and when him what he learned at school, we get the classic âI dunnoâ or âđ€·.â
Yeah, super fun convos.
Then one day, he lights up about one of his classes. Why was he hyped? Nope, wasnât multiplying by 3sâŠit was because a teacher played songs from KâPop Demon Hunters during class.
Boom.
Tiny move, massive buyâin.
You canât build a skyscraper on JellâO (ya hear me, Jim Halpert?)!
Spend the first nine weeks pouring concrete and getting that solid foundation in your classroom.
Learn names fast and use them often.
Take notes of their passions, then plug them into class like cheat codes.
Celebrate tiny wins at the door.
Steal examples from their playlists, cleats, and sketchbooks.
When kids (and adults) feel seen and understood, theyâll run through walls for you like theyâre trying to board Platform 9Ÿ.
Lay the foundation now and the rest of the year is gonna roll smoother than that song âSoda Popâ that my kid still wonât stop singing. đ

đ Tarver Book Club
BOOK
The Creative Act: A Way of Being
AUTHOR
Rick Rubin
RECAP
Rubin treats creativity as a way of paying attention and steadily refining. In class, that looks like protecting the fragile âseedâ stage, using clear constraints to focus thinking, and teaching students to improve work by removing what doesnât serve the idea.
TAKEAWAYS
Creativity is a practice, not a lightning bolt.
Protect early drafts, add simple constraints, and coach students to refine by subtraction.
Cut. Out. What. Doesnât. Matter. Unless it matters for the culture you wanna set in your classroom.
Notice more, judge less: make room for messy first tries, then edit.
Constraints create focus: clear boundaries unlock better student ideas.
Be the gardener, not the engineer: set calm routines, give attention, let ideas grow!
PRACTICAL APPLICATION
Start projects with 6â8 minutes of quiet âseed timeâ where students capture ideas without evaluation, then have them remove one element from their draft to make the main idea clearer, followed by two curiosity questions from a peer instead of a grade!
